What is a narrative designer?

A Narrative Designer is responsible for shaping the story, dialogue, and overall storytelling experience in a game. They collaborate with writers, game designers, and other developers to ensure that narrative elements integrate seamlessly with gameplay. Unlike traditional writers, they focus on how story interacts with mechanics, level design, and player choices. Their work involves character development, world-building, and ensuring consistency in the game's narrative structure.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a narrative designer?

To thrive as a Narrative Designer, you need a strong background in creative writing, storytelling, and an understanding of narrative techniques, often supported by a degree in writing, game design, or a related field. Familiarity with interactive scripting tools, branching dialogue systems, and game engines such as Unity or Unreal Engine is typically required. Collaboration, adaptability, and excellent communication skills are vital for working with multidisciplinary teams and incorporating feedback. These skills ensure the creation of compelling, player-centric narratives and smooth integration of story elements within interactive media.

What are common collaborative responsibilities for a narrative designer within a game development team?

Narrative Designers regularly work alongside game designers, artists, and programmers to ensure that story elements align with gameplay mechanics and visual storytelling. They often participate in brainstorming sessions, review narrative implementation in-game, and revise scripts based on team feedback. Effective cross-department collaboration is key, as the narrative must support and enhance the overall player experience while fitting technical and design limitations. This collaborative environment requires strong communication and a willingness to iterate on ideas based on input from various team members.

How to get into narrative designer?

To become a narrative designer, develop strong storytelling skills, a background in writing or game design, and proficiency with tools like Twine or Ink. Building a portfolio of writing samples and gaining experience through internships or indie projects can also help entry into the field.
